         <title>The Future of Custom Food Boxes and Its Impact on the Environment</title>
         <author>henryevan04</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/henryevan04/2r6rhmre66jci0hn/wish/2474538764</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div><br>The packaging industry has experienced tremendous growth in recent years, and food packaging has become one of the most significant segments within the industry. The rise in the demand for takeout food and the need for convenient packaging solutions has led to the development of custom food boxes. These boxes are designed to meet the specific needs of food businesses, providing both protection and convenience for consumers.<br><br></div><div>In the future, the demand for <a href="https://tycoonpackaging.com/product-category/custom-food-boxes/">custom food packaging</a> is only expected to increase, and this increase will have a significant impact on the environment. The production of packaging materials, such as plastic and paper, has a significant carbon footprint, and the disposal of these materials can also have a negative impact on the environment. Therefore, it's essential to consider the environmental impact of custom food boxes and explore ways to minimize their environmental footprint.<br><br></div><div><br>The environmental impact of custom food boxes can be reduced in several ways, starting with the materials used in their production. The use of biodegradable and compostable materials, such as plant-based bioplastics and paper, can help reduce the environmental impact of custom food boxes. Biodegradable materials break down over time, reducing the amount of waste that ends up in landfills, while compostable materials can be used as a fertilizer for crops, reducing the need for synthetic fertilizers.<br><br></div><div><br>Another way to minimize the environmental impact of custom food boxes is through the use of recycled materials. The use of recycled paper, for example, reduces the need for virgin paper, which requires the cutting down of trees and contributes to deforestation. The use of recycled plastic in custom food boxes also reduces the amount of waste that ends up in landfills and oceans.<br><br></div><div><br>In addition to the materials used, the design of custom food boxes can also impact the environment. The use of lighter weight materials, for example, reduces the amount of energy required to transport the boxes, while the use of designs that reduce the amount of waste, such as nesting boxes, can also help minimize the environmental impact.<br><br></div><div><br>Another important consideration in the future of custom food boxes is the issue of waste. The rise in the demand for takeout food has led to a significant increase in the amount of food packaging waste generated. This waste can end up in landfills, where it contributes to environmental pollution, or in oceans, where it can harm marine life. To minimize this impact, it's essential to implement proper waste management practices, including recycling and composting.<br><br></div><div><br>In addition to reducing the environmental impact of custom food boxes, it's also important to consider the impact of these boxes on human health. The use of certain materials, such as Bisphenol A (BPA), in the production of custom food boxes has raised concerns about the potential health effects of these materials. BPA is a chemical used in the production of certain types of plastic, and it can leach into food and cause harm to human health.<br><br></div><div><br>To address this issue, the use of BPA-free materials in the production of custom food boxes is becoming more widespread. Additionally, the use of natural materials, such as bamboo, cotton, and silicone, can also help reduce the potential health risks associated with custom food boxes.<br><br></div><div><br>Finally, it's essential to consider the impact of custom food boxes on the economy. The rise in the demand for custom food boxes has led to the creation of new jobs in the packaging industry and has provided a boost to the economy. In the future, the continued growth of the packaging industry, and the increasing demand for sustainable and eco-friendly packaging solutions, will provide even more opportunities for economic growth.<br><br></div><div><br>In conclusion, the future of custom food boxes is bright, and the demand for these boxes is expected to increase in the coming years. However, it's important to consider the impact of these boxes on the environment, human health, and the economy. By using biodegradable and compostable materials, recycled materials, designing boxes with minimal waste, implementing proper waste management practices, using BPA-free materials, and focusing on the use of natural materials, the impact of custom food boxes on the environment can be reduced. Additionally, the growth of the packaging industry and the demand for sustainable packaging solutions will provide new opportunities for economic growth. It's crucial for businesses and consumers to be aware of these issues and work together to minimize the negative impact of custom food boxes on the environment.</div>]]></description>
